Sting will spend much of the summer on a world tour, performing his most-renowned songs alongside the Royal Philharmonic Concert Orchestra.  The very special concert event will be taking place at Mohegan Sun Arena on Tuesday, July 6th at 7:30pm.

Last year, Sting unveiled If On a Winter’s Night…, which peaked at #6 on The Billboard 200 and has since been certified gold.   The 45-piece Royal Philharmonic Concert Orchestra will reinvent a variety of hits by Sting and The Police, including “Roxanne,” “Next to You,” “Every Little Thing She Does Is Magic,” “Every Breath You Take” and “Desert Rose,” among others.  Sting will also be joined by a quartet consisting of guitarist Dominic Miller, multi-percussionist David Cossin, vocalist Jo Lawry and bassist Ira Coleman.
